Ibn Arabi was a prominent figure in the realm of Sufism, his teachings profoundly influencing the spiritual journey of countless seekers. His magnum opus, The Fusus al-Hikam, serves as a luminous beacon illuminating the path toward divine union. Through its intricate tapestry of allegorical tales and profound philosophical discourses, the Fusus al-Hikam unveils the essence of creation and humanity's inherent connection to the Divine.
Ibn Arabi posits that the Sufi path is a ascent toward self-realization, a gradual unfolding of one's true nature as a manifestation of the divine light. He emphasizes the importance of passion for Allah as the driving force behind this transformative transformation. Through love's effulgence, the seeker transcends the limitations of the ego and merges with the infinite ocean of being.
The Fusus al-Hikam elucidates various stages on the Sufi path, highlighting the challenges and triumphs encountered along the way. Ibn Arabi underscores the need for practice as well as mystical direction. He offers practical wisdom and profound insights to navigate the read more complexities of the human experience, ultimately guiding the seeker towards the ultimate goal of annihilation in God – fana|mawlid|annihilation.
